Cry for the wild

The plantive howling of the wolf,
Should tell us where we are,
The distance from its end to ours,
Is really not that far,
If thinking its a selfish cry,
We do not understand,
When it cries out it cries for us,
We live on common land,
For what we now refuse to hear,
We dont soon make amends,
We quickly learn this fact of life,
On earth our life depends.
